**Mgmt Meeting Minutes — Retiring the Brightline Range**

Quick recap for sales leads at Fenholt Supplies: we agreed to retire the Brightline fixture range by year-end. Remaining stock moves to clearance pricing next month, and accounts on standing orders get migrated to the Lumetta range. Trade-in incentives were approved in principle. The confidential note on next steps sits just below.

board note of bajof-bajeg: The pricing group signed off on a budget of $13.4 million for Project Sildor. The renewal with Lamixek Holdings closes at $48.9 million a year, 49 percent above the last contract.

Handover — Brightfen Pilot

Quick note for finance before I move on: churn in the Brightfen pilot hit 14% last month, mostly smaller accounts dropping after onboarding. Marit's retention calls are helping, and Tessway renewals look solid. Keep an eye on the discount cohort. There's one sensitive point I've left for the confidential note below.

board note of tadup-tajog: Headcount on the Oliiel team goes from 31 to 88 by the end of February. Gross margin on Oliiel came in at 62 percent against a plan of 29 percent.

Welcome to on-call for Parcelglass exports! When an export job fails, it lands in the retry queue and gets three automatic attempts with backoff. If all three fail, the job is parked and pages you. Nine times out of ten it's a stale template — just requeue via the admin panel. If requeueing doesn't help, check the parked_jobs table directly for the error payload. The export database connection string is below.

primary connection of kagap-bahif = mysql://oliath_svc:Bt5WL4OffJggwF@db-e739.zemvarsys.test:5432/soriel